71 60 560 Replacing release unit for trailer tow hitch

Necessary preliminary tasks: 

Disconnect plug connection (1).

Unclip cable holder (2).

Fig 1: Identifying Trailer Tow Hitch Plug Connection And Cable Holder
G04753824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Release screw (1).

Tightening torque: 5 Nm

Installation: 

Replace microencapsulated screw (1).

NOTE: Shown without gear unit for purposes of clarity.

Fit special tool 72 0 010 (lever) so that ribs (2) of retainer (1) are inserted into special tool.

IMPORTANT: Make sure special tool 72 0 010 (lever) is correctly positioned.

Special tool 72 0 010 must be inserted between trailer tow hitch (1) and gear unit (2).

Installation: 

Drive special tool 72 0 010 in direction of arrow upwards and remove retainer of gear unit (1).

Detach gear unit (1).

If it is not possible to detach the gear unit:

Release gear unit .

Installation: 

Replace sealing ring (1) and coat with oil.

Installation: 

Align lock (2) on gear unit to release pin (3).

Fit gear unit (1) up to stop.

IMPORTANT:

Fit retaining lug on retainer (1) as pictured.

Retainer (1) must snap firmly into correctly!

Fit special tool 72 0 010 onto retainer (1).

Set retainer (1) on gear unit (2) and snap into place with special tool 72 0 010 in direction of arrow.

Installation: 

Check protective cap (3) for damage and replace if necessary.

When replacing protective cap:

If necessary, cut off cable tie (1) from gear unit (2).
